Configure mediator costs
Typical agent commission is 3.57% per side (including VAT at 19%). Since the 2020 reform, buyer and seller split costs equally.

What does notary cost include in the deed?
Costs include: draft contract, certification, notice of termination (pre-notice registration), termination (property transfer). The land register entry is separate but coordinated by the notary.
Who pays the realtor in Germany?
From December 23, 2020 (§656c BGB), in residential sales, the buyer and seller split the brokerage fee equally. If the seller has appointed a mediator, they cannot charge the buyer more than what they pay themselves.
